September Weather in Manning,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In Manning, United States, the average temperature in September is a pleasant 20°C (68°F). While the temperature can vary, it may drop to a chilly 4°C (40°F) or rise to a warm 35°C (96°F). During this month, expect 98 mm (3.8 in) of precipitation over approximately 9 days, with humidity levels averaging around 75%. Enjoy the balanced climate and prepare for occasional rain!

How September Weather in Manning Compares to Other Months

Weather in Manning var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ares September’s weather to other months in Manning,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Manning, showing how September’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-5°C (23°F)28 mm (1.1 inches)76%moderate
February Weather-5°C (23°F)40 mm (1.6 inches)80%moderate
March Weather4°C (39°F)77 mm (3.0 inches)73%high
April Weather9°C (48°F)65 mm (2.5 inches)74%very high
May Weather16°C (61°F)167 mm (6.6 inches)78%very high
June Weather23°C (74°F)102 mm (4.0 inches)82%extreme
July Weather24°C (76°F)67 mm (2.6 inches)83%very high
August Weather23°C (73°F)110 mm (4.3 inches)80%very high
September Weather20°C (68°F)98 mm (3.8 inches)75%very high
October Weather10°C (51°F)120 mm (4.7 inches)75%high
November Weather3°C (38°F)35 mm (1.4 inches)82%moderate
December Weather-2°C (29°F)38 mm (1.5 inches)83%low
